Poetry from the beloved lead guitarist of the multiplatinum legendary band Triumph
Rik Emmett’s second collection originated during the dark limbo of COVID-19: 2021-22. Five parts go from autofictional narration to observations on the modern world, moving inside out, then outside in. Eventually, Leaning Into It looks beyond.
Leaning Into … what? The prevailing chaos of narcissistic, egotistical, patrimonial power-mongering lends these poems renewed vitality, as the author’s frustration and disappointment with current undemocratic global politics play out.
How much leaning gets us a tiny bit closer to wisdom? Emmett favors the balatrones, jesters, fools, poets, comedians, and atheists in his social media feeds. “Power” ignores the balanced values of a sense of humor and a good-natured humility — but this poetry takes on the world as it is, ultimately leaning into hope.
